The Pit Stop

March 28, 2010 3:14 PM

The Race Has Been Postponed....

until Monday as rain just keeps on falling on this track. The start time will be noon and the race can be seen on Fox.

This will mean that Denny Hamlin will be postponing his surgery on his knee by at least one day.

The weather in Florida for the IRL race is even worse and they can run on rain tires.  Even that race could run on Monday, by the look of things.


The IRL race has even been postponed until Monday at 10AM and that will get aired on ESPN2.

A Member Of